This important tribute to one of Africa’s most visionary directors, film lovers, filmmakers and journalists takes us on a journey through the life and work of the late Senegalese director Ousmane Sembene, who died in 2007. Set partly on Yoff’s Beach, a fishing village where Sembene lived, this potent documentary includes excerpts from his films and written texts, plus clips of his teaching the Art of Cinema in Cannes in 2005 and interviews featuring friends and admirers like Danny Glover, Charles Burnett and Haile Gerima.
